Moisturizer for dry skin is an essential component of any skincare routine. Dry skin is a common issue affecting many people, especially in winter when the air is cold and dry. Moisturizer helps to replenish lost moisture and nourish the skin, leaving it feeling nourished, supple and soft.

Choosing the best moisturizer for dry skin can be daunting, but certain factors can help you make an informed decision. The first thing to consider is the type of moisturizer. There are three types of moisturizers: creams, lotions, and ointments. Creams are typically the best option for dry skin, as they are thicker and more hydrating than lotions.

When choosing a moisturizer for dry skin, it is also important to look for ingredients that will help soothe and nurture the skin. Some key ingredients to look for include ceramides, hyaluronic acid, squalane, Vitamin E, Provitamin B5, and kokum butter and so. These actives work together to lock in moisture and keep the skin hydrated.

Well, now that you know how to choose the best moisturizer for dry skin, it is essential to incorporate it into your skincare routine. Here are some moisturizing tips to keep your skin looking healthy and hydrated throughtout the day:

1.Apply moisturizer immediately after showering or bathing while your skin is still damp- this will help to lock in moisture and prevent dryness.

2.Using a humidifier in your home will add moisture to the air. This is important during the winter months when the air is dry.

3.Drink enough water throughout the day to keep your skin hydrated from the inside out.

4.Don't take hot showers and baths, as they strip the skin of natural oils and lead to dryness.

5.Exfoliate often to remove dead skin cells and allow moisturizer to penetrate more deeply.

FAQS

1.What should I look for in a moisturizer for dry skin?

Look for moisturizers that contain humectants such as glycerin or hyaluronic acid, as they help to attract moisture to the skin. Additionally, occlusive ingredients like Provitamin B5, squalane, or kokum butter can help to lock in moisture and prevent water loss from the skin.

2.How often should I apply moisturizer to my dry skin?

You should apply moisturizer to dry skin once in the morning and once at night. You may need to apply more frequently if your skin is particularly dry.

3.Can using too much moisturizer cause my skin to become oily?

No, using too much moisturizer will not make your skin oily. However, using a moisturizer that is too heavy for your skin type may lead to clogged pores and breakouts. Be sure to choose a moisturizer that is appropriate for your skin type.

4.Are there any other tips for keeping my dry skin hydrated?

Yes, there are a few other things you can do to help keep your dry skin hydrated. Avoid using hot water when washing your face, as it can strip your skin of its natural oils. Instead, use lukewarm water and a gentle cleanser. Additionally, try to avoid using harsh exfoliants or scrubs, as they can further irritate dry skin. Finally, consider using a humidifier in your home to add moisture to the air.
